Barbra Streisand & James Brolin Still Holding Hands & Going on Dates Like Teens – What’s Their Secret?

After over two decades together, Barbra Streisand and James Brolin’s marriage still feels like a teenage romance. They hold hands and enjoy dates with the same enthusiasm as in their early days. Their 26-year union is a testament to enduring love, characterized by a deep connection that has only grown stronger over the years.

Their relationship began with an unexpected spark on a blind date, where Streisand was surprised by Brolin’s clean-shaven look, contrary to her expectations. Despite a rocky start, their bond deepened, leading to their marriage in 1998. Both had previous marriages—Streisand to Elliot Gould and Brolin to Jane Agee and Jan Smithers—but found lasting happiness with each other.

Brolin often reflects on their shared adventures, like long phone calls during his filming in the Philippines, where they talked for hours despite the expense. Their connection remains vibrant, with Brolin praising the joy Streisand brings into his life. They continue to keep the spark alive through thoughtful gestures, spontaneous outings, and enjoying their roles as grandparents, making every day together feel special.
